Is an appellate court a civil court?

Appellate courts are technically not classified as criminal or civil since those kinds of of trials are not held there. In addition appellate courts hear both civil and criminal appeals. There is no separate criminal appellate court or civil appellate court.

Which court is higher criminal or civil?

Neither criminal nor civil courts are inherently "higher" than the other; they serve different purposes within the legal system. Criminal courts handle cases involving violations of criminal law, where the state prosecutes individuals for crimes, while civil courts deal with disputes between individuals or entities, often involving compensation for damages. The hierarchy of courts typically refers to levels such as trial courts, appellate courts, and supreme courts, rather than to the type of law they address.
